The journey has not been easy for 29-year-old Akash. Born on 25 November 1993. Akash’s father was in the army. The father did not think that his son would become a cricketer. Rather, being good in studies, he was given civil engineering education. But Akash wanted him to make a name for himself as a bowler, which eventually happened.
